Unraveling the Mystique: The Best Filipino Mythology Books

The Philippines, an archipelago of more than 7,000 islands, is a land brimming with diverse cultures, traditions, and a rich tapestry of folklore. Embedded in the hearts of the Filipino people are captivating myths, legends, and tales that have been passed down through generations. These stories provide a unique glimpse into the country’s history, beliefs, and the enduring spirit of its people. In this blog, we’ll embark on a journey through the best Filipino mythology books, each offering a doorway to the enchanting world of Filipino folklore.

1. “Philippine Mythology” by Jocano F. Landa

Jocano F. Landa’s “Philippine Mythology” is a treasure trove of insights into the country’s mythic traditions. Focusing on the Philippines’ numerous ethnic groups, Jocano explores the distinct mythologies of each group, highlighting their creation stories, deities, and cosmologies. This book serves as an excellent introduction to the captivating world of Filipino mythology.

2. “Philippine Folk Literature: The Myths” by Damiana L. Eugenio

A pioneering work in the field of Filipino folklore, Damiana L. Eugenio’s “Philippine Folk Literature: The Myths” is a comprehensive collection of myths and legends. This book delves into the diverse myths of the Philippines, encompassing narratives from various regions, making it a valuable resource for those seeking a deeper understanding of the country’s cultural diversity.

3. “Philippine Mythology, Gods & Goddesses of the Tagalog Region” by Joonee Garcia

Joonee Garcia’s book is a fascinating exploration of the deities and myths of the Tagalog region. “Philippine Mythology, Gods & Goddesses of the Tagalog Region” takes readers on a journey through the rich folklore of this prominent Filipino group, providing a captivating glimpse into the pantheon of deities that have shaped their stories and beliefs.

4. “Mga Kuwento ni Lola Basyang” (Tales of Lola Basyang) by Severino Reyes

Severino Reyes’ “Mga Kuwento ni Lola Basyang” is a timeless collection of enchanting stories that have been a beloved part of Filipino culture for generations. Lola Basyang, a beloved storyteller, weaves captivating tales that bring to life the magic and wonder of Filipino mythology. This collection is an excellent choice for both children and adults, making it a fantastic introduction to Filipino folklore.

5. “Visayan Folktales” by Mellie Leandicho Lopez

“Visayan Folktales” by Mellie Leandicho Lopez is a remarkable compilation of folktales from the Visayan region of the Philippines. These stories are a testament to the Visayans’ unique cultural heritage and offer a window into their beliefs and traditions. Lopez’s meticulous research and storytelling make this book an essential read for those interested in regional Filipino mythology.

6. “Mythology Class” by Arnold Arre

For those who prefer the art of graphic novels, “Mythology Class” by Arnold Arre is a captivating choice. This graphic novel takes readers on a modern-day adventure that intertwines Filipino mythology with contemporary life. Arre’s stunning illustrations and compelling narrative make this book a standout addition to the world of Filipino mythology.

7. “Tales from the 7,000 Isles: Filipino Folk Stories” by Dianne de Las Casas and Zarah C. Gagatiga

“Tales from the 7,000 Isles” is a delightful anthology of Filipino folk stories for young readers. Written by Dianne de Las Casas and Zarah C. Gagatiga, this collection introduces children to the enchanting world of Filipino mythology. The book beautifully combines storytelling with vibrant illustrations to engage young minds and foster an appreciation for Filipino culture.

8. “The Aswang Project: A Study of the Philippine Monster” by Dr. Maximo Ramos

Dr. Maximo Ramos’ “The Aswang Project” is a fascinating exploration of one of the most notorious creatures in Filipino mythology – the aswang. This book is not only an in-depth study of the creature but also a reflection of the role of myth in culture and society. For those intrigued by the darker aspects of Filipino folklore, this book is a must-read.

9. “Sirens of Selda: A Filipino Odyssey” by Pauline Mangilog-Saltarin

Pauline Mangilog-Saltarin’s “Sirens of Selda” offers a fresh take on Filipino mythology in the context of an epic adventure. The book reimagines classic myths, intertwining them into a modern-day narrative that explores themes of identity, love, and self-discovery. It’s a unique and captivating addition to the world of Filipino mythology literature.

10. “Filipino Ghost Stories” by Alex G. Paman

While not entirely focused on mythology, “Filipino Ghost Stories” by Alex G. Paman delves into the rich world of Filipino folklore and superstitions surrounding the supernatural. It’s a spine-tingling journey through the ghostly and eerie aspects of Filipino culture, providing a different perspective on the country’s beliefs and legends.
